打印
[开发工具]

【ST开发视频】仿真测试

[复制链接]
783|6
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
tinnu|  楼主 | 2019-4-6 21:06 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 tinnu 于 2019-4-7 11:08 编辑

(一)TOUCHGFX
一开始听说TOUCHGFX可以图形配置了,非常兴奋,手上那块积灰的F412似乎终于可以动用了,之前买来本来是想开发EMWIN的,结果只移植了个显示,触摸是死活不行。
可是等我兴冲冲地一打开配置菜单,犹如一盘冷水浇了下来:

全是这种大屏幕的dis板,此时此刻我又感受到了作为中国人的传统特质:

那么只好simulation一下啦

(二)界面
菜单看上去也挺简单,基本都向扁平化设计发展。

左上是不同screen切换,左下是控件选择,右边是属性设置。

(三)
screen1
上图就是第一个screen,添加了一个box把整个界面罩住,中间一个button with lables。
在右侧功能栏为button添加功能:

这里功能的大概意思就是点击的时候切换screen。
实际上这个时候还没有screen2,因为还没有添加,需要在左上角screen窗口添加screen2.

screen2
screen2添加了一个animatedImage,这是一个可以播放动图的容器。

需要注意,图片文件路径可以包含中文字符,但文件本身不能有中文字符和下划线之类的,我才改了二十来张文件名,感觉手腕关节炎都开始发作了。

此外还有左上角的普通image和下面的button
增加一个点击button,image就移动的功能:


(四)运行
没有板子就不需要生成代码之类的,直接点击右上角的run simulation。
这个时间相当的长,而且容易出错,即使没有做任何修改都会重新编译一次
运行效果:

工程上传不了,只能放云盘了:链接:https://pan.baidu.com/s/1s2zqrwRX2kIPpHQQCNuVyQ 密码:n1ql


使用特权

评论回复
沙发
请叫我树人| | 2019-4-8 10:31 | 只看该作者
感谢分享啊! 真是不错啊!

使用特权

评论回复
板凳
tinnu|  楼主 | 2019-4-8 22:02 | 只看该作者
请叫我树人 发表于 2019-4-8 10:31
感谢分享啊! 真是不错啊!

哈哈,见笑了,只是按部就班过了一遍,没能在板子上跑很可惜啊。
希望以后st能支持更多板子的图形配置

使用特权

评论回复
地板
磨砂| | 2019-5-5 12:58 | 只看该作者
非常感谢楼主分享

使用特权

评论回复
5
晓伍| | 2019-5-5 13:01 | 只看该作者
很不错的帖子

使用特权

评论回复
6
八层楼| | 2019-5-5 13:15 | 只看该作者
非常感谢楼主分享

使用特权

评论回复
7
观海| | 2019-5-5 13:31 | 只看该作者
经验啊 感谢分享

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

15

主题

71

帖子

0

粉丝